Output 7eebb5348d9080dcc3c83f3f2464e0d3f78ef742e1f528043d66d64b14f7703b:1

value
524630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f9cdde8b2232536da8b3236143017c81958287a OP_EQUAL
address
3DKmfCq7paake6UgqMhbqa5GP5PZSr3mVZ
transaction
7eebb5348d9080dcc3c83f3f2464e0d3f78ef742e1f528043d66d64b14f7703b
confirmations
459262
spent
true